About The Position

The Director, Department of Programs (DoP) ensures Geneva’s research and development enterprise operates at the highest level of performance, accountability, and impact. This leader is charged with translating Geneva’s vision into measurable outcomes, driving execution of strategic priorities and key performance indicators (KPIs), and strengthening organizational capabilities to deliver consistent value to sponsors, partners, and employees. The Director of DoP oversees the design, growth, and management of Geneva’s research portfolios, ensuring research activities are executed with rigor, operational excellence, sustainability, and growth. By aligning people, systems, and partnerships, the Director of DoP plays a critical role in positioning Geneva as a leader in military medical research.

This is a hybrid position requiring onsite work two days per week. Candidates must be located in or near Bethesda, MD or San Antonio, TX. Employment is contingent upon successful completion of a background check.

Salary Range

$160,000 - $180,000. Salaries are determined based on several factors including external market data, internal equity, and the candidate’s related knowledge, skills, and abilities for the position.

QUALIFICATIONS

  •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, Management, Public Health, or related field required; advanced degree (MBA, MHA, MPH, or equivalent) strongly preferred.
  • 12 years of progressive leadership experience in research administration, research operations, or related non-profit, academic, or government environments.
  • Experience leading R&D business development in a DoD, industry, or higher education environment.
  • Proven track record building pre-award capacity that actively drives proposals including capture planning, non-technical volume ownership, lay reviews, and submission readiness.
  • Expertise in federal and non-federal sponsor regulations, contracts, and grants management.
  • Demonstrated success in building and scaling high-performing teams with clear accountability and measurable results.
  • Demonstrated financial acumen in profitability management of federally funded research and industry-sponsored clinical trials.
  • Proven record of shaping and executing growth strategies that expand research funding, strengthen R&D pipelines, and build institutional partnerships.
  • Strong operational acumen, with experience in compliance oversight, risk management, and QA/QC system implementation.
  • Skilled in developing and applying innovative approaches, techniques, and systems modernization to improve efficiency, strengthen organizational learning, and deliver responsive services to customers.
  • Exceptional communication, relationship management, and external engagement skills across a variety of stakeholder groups.
  • Commitment to Geneva’s values of Integrity, Superior Customer Service, Quality, Teamwork, Innovation, and Respect for All.

MANAGEMENT R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Recruit, develop, and lead DoP personnel including the Associate Directors of DoP and R&D Business Development (BD).
  • Build and sustain a culture of accountability, collaboration, and inclusivity across the department.
  • Provide direction, mentorship, and development opportunities to ensure professional growth, peak performance, and employee retention.
  • Set and socialize an intentional culture and expected behaviors aligned to the mission and core values; model them visibly.
  • Drive cross-departmental alignment and execution in partnership with Finance, People Operations, Information Management/Security, and Corporate Strategy & Communications.
  • Ensure all staff comply with Geneva policies, procedures, and standard operating practices.
  • Plan and facilitate regular meetings to ensure clarity of priorities, open communication, and accountability to results.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Lead annual goal setting, performance monitoring, and reporting for DoP.
  • Actively serve on the Department Leadership Team to ensure Geneva’s vision is translated into actionable strategies and measurable outcomes.
  • Ensure compliance with federal, non-federal, and Geneva regulations, including human subjects’ protection, animal welfare, intellectual property, conflict of interest, and cost-accounting standards.
  • Advance modernization of enterprise systems, data, and QA/QC processes to strengthen efficiency, transparency, and decision-making.
  • Benchmark Geneva’s practices against leading institutions to adopt and execute best-in-class standards.
  • Conduct risk analyses and develop mitigation strategies to reduce organizational vulnerabilities.
  • Oversee departmental budget development, monitoring, and variance management to ensure responsible growth and resource optimization.
  • Deliver accurate and timely reporting of meaningful metrics to demonstrate performance, customer satisfaction, and strategic impact.
  • Manage long-term planning for research operations, aligning people, infrastructure, and technology with growth projections.
  • Work with Finance to articulate audit readiness and ensure audit-ready records within DoP.
  • In coordination with Senior Leadership, direct business development strategy through the Associate Director of BD, ensuring sustainable growth of Geneva’s R&D portfolios.
  • Cultivate and steward sponsor relationships and external collaborations to increase Geneva’s visibility and competitiveness.
  • Represent Geneva at conferences, symposia, and policy forums to enhance Geneva’s reputation and thought leadership.
